How to Check Python Version Linuxize

To find out which version of Python is installed on your system run the python version or python V command python version The command will print the default Python version in this case that is 2 7 15 The version installed on your system may be different Python 2 7 15

What version of Python do I have Ask Ubuntu

What version of Python do I have Ask Ubuntu, If that s all you need you re done But to see every version of python in your system takes a bit more In Ubuntu we can check the resolution with readlink f which python In default cases in 14 04 this will simply point to usr bin python2 7 We can chain this in to show the version of that version of Python
